
#w { width:100%; height:90px; background-color:#FFF}
#bg{width:1004px; margin:auto; height:100%;}
.hide{ display:none;}

#top { width:1000px; height:90px; margin:auto; }
.menu{ height:90px;}
.menu #logo{ float:left; overflow:hidden}
.menu ul{ float:right; padding-top:30px;}
	.menu ul li{ float:left; height:30px}
	.menu ul li a{ display:block; width:100px; font-size:15px; font-family:microsoft yahei; color:#333; height:30px; text-align:center;overflow:hidden}
	.menu ul li a:hover{ color:#F63}
	
	
	/*菜单*/

.index_bg01 {BACKGROUND: url(banner_bg01.jpg) repeat-x 0px 90px}
.index_bg02 {BACKGROUND: url(banner_bg02.jpg) repeat-x 0px 90px}
.index_bg03 {BACKGROUND: url(banner_bg03.jpg) repeat-x 0px 90px}
.index_bg04 {BACKGROUND: url(banner_bg04.jpg) repeat-x 0px 90px}
.index_bg05 {BACKGROUND: url(banner_bg05.jpg) repeat-x 0px 90px}
#warp {P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-LEFT: 0px; WIDTH: 100%; PADDING-RIGHT: 0px; HEIGHT:450px;; PADDING-TOP: 0px; background:#FF7800}
.banner {Z-INDEX: 99; MARGIN: 0px auto; WIDTH: 1000px; HEIGHT:450px; _width:1000px}
.banner_l {MARGIN-TOP: 147px; WIDTH: 23px; FLOAT: left}
.banner_r {MARGIN-TOP: 147px; WIDTH: 23px; FLOAT: left}
.bannerImg {POSITION: relative;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-LEFT: 0px; WIDTH:1000px; PADDING-RIGHT: 0px; FLOAT: left; PADDING-TOP: 0px}
.bannerImg .bannerPage {POSITION: absolute; TOP: 395px; LEFT: 440px}
.bannerImg .bannerPage A {MARGIN-RIGHT: 2px}
.bannerImg .bannerPage A IMG {VERTICAL-ALIGN: middle}
.slides_container {POSITION: relative; WIDTH:1000px; OVERFLOW: hidden; height:450px;}
.pagination {MARGIN: 26px auto 0px}
.pagination LI {MARGIN: 0px 1px; FLOAT: left}
.pagination LI A {BACKGROUND-IMAGE: url(pagination.png); WIDTH: 15px; DISPLAY: block; BACKGROUND-POSITION: 0px -1px; FLOAT: left; HEIGHT: 0px; OVERFLOW: hidden; PADDING-TOP: 12px}
.pagination LI.current A {BACKGROUND-POSITION: 0px -18px}
/*滚动图*/

.neirong { width:1000px; overflow:hidden; display:table; margin:0 auto; margin-bottom:30px;}
.news,.games { float:left; width:500px;}
.news_tit {background:url(tit_tu.gif) no-repeat 0 -10px; height:46px;}
.news_tu { float:left; width:110px; height:141px; margin:6px 0 0 10px;}
.news_list {float:left; width:360px; color:#aaaaaa; margin-left:10px;}
.news_list li { float:left; width:370px; height:28px; border-bottom:1px dashed #e3e3e3; line-height:28px;}
.news_list li a{ color:#333333}
.games_tit {background:url(tit_tu.gif) no-repeat 10px -55px; height:46px;}
.games_tu li { float:left; width:96px; height:96px; margin:25px; text-align:center}


#f_w{ float:left;width:100%; height:130px; background-color:#f4f4f4;}
.footer{ border-top:1px solid #eee8da; width:1000px; margin:45px auto 0; height:130px; background:#f4f4f4; margin:0 auto;}
	.footer-logo{ background:url(logo.gif) no-repeat; float:left; width:150px; height:50px; margin:25px 30px 0 114px; text-indent:-99em; overflow:hidden}
	.footer-info{ float:left; color:#666; padding-top:30px;}
	.footer-info li a{ color:#ff8000;}
	.footer-info li a:hover{ text-decoration:underline; color:#f60}
	.footer-info li a.first{ margin-left:0!important}
/*底部信息*/


#us {width:100%; height:500px; background:url(us_bg.jpg);}
.us_tu {margin:auto; width:438px; height:320px; padding:180px 0 0 562px;background:url(us.jpg); color:#504f4d}
.us_tu a {color:#0095d9}

#nei_top_tu {width:100%; height:160px; background:url(top_tu1.jpg) no-repeat center;}
#nei_top_tu2 {width:100%; height:160px; background:url(top_tu2.jpg) no-repeat center}
#nei_top_tu3 {width:100%; height:160px; background:url(top_tu3.jpg) no-repeat center;}
#nei_top_tu4 {width:100%; height:160px; background:url(top_tu4.jpg) no-repeat center}
#nei_rong { width:1000px; height:auto; margin:auto; color:#666666; display:table}

.nei_left { float:left; width:220px; height:400px;}
.nei_right { float:right; width:780px; height:auto}

.us_tit { background:url(tit_tu.gif) no-repeat 10px -100px; height:90px;}
.us_tit_event { background:url(event.gif) no-repeat 15px 20px; height:90px;}
.about_tit {background-position:10px -185px}
/* .chan_tit {background-position:10px -270px} */
.chan_tit{
	background-size: 0 0;
	position: relative; 
   }
   .chan_tit div{
	 height: 100%;
	 line-height: 90px;
	 position: absolute;
	 left: 0;
	 top: 0;
	 font-size: 30px;
	 /* font-weight: bold; */
   }
.left_chan_tit {background:url(tit_tu.gif) no-repeat 0px -350px; height:90px;}
.news_tit {background-position:10px -497px; height:90px;}


.a_list {float:left; width:360px; color:#aaaaaa; margin-left:10px;}
.a_list ul{ line-height:24px; font-size:13px; text-indent:2em; padding-top:4px;}
.a_tit {background:url(tit_tu.gif); background-position:10px -562px; height:90px;}

.newsright_tit {background-position:10px -422px}
.us_tit p { float:right; margin:46px 10px 0 0;}
.us_tit_event p { float:right; margin:46px 10px 0 0;}
.us_neirong { width:1000px; height:479px; background:url(ys_bgtu.gif) center right no-repeat; padding:36px 0 0 0px;}
.us_neirong_zi { padding-top:62px;}

.us_caidan {width:980px; height:60px; margin-left:20px;}
.us_caidan li { float:left; width:100px; height:36px; margin-left:2px; text-align:center; line-height:36px; color:#FFF;}
.us_caidan li a {width:100px; height:36px; margin-left:2px; text-align:center; line-height:36px; color:#666;display:block;}
.us_caidan_m1 { background-color:#8f8f8f}
.job_neirong { float:left; width:480px; height:auto; margin:0 0 20px 20px; color:#777}
.job_neirong h1 { font-size:16px; font-weight:bold; margin-bottom:20px;}

.chan_list { width:200px; margin:0 10px ;}
.chan_list li { float:left; width:200px; height:40px; line-height:40px;border-bottom:1px #ddd solid; color:#fff; }
.chan_list li a {width:200px; height:40px; line-height:40px; display:block; color:#454545;}
.dangqian {background:url(chanp.gif) no-repeat; font-weight:bold; }
.chan_list li.dangqian  a{ color:#fff; }


.nei_right_nei {width:780px;min-height:995px;_height:995px; height:auto;}
.xiazai{ float:left; width:750px; margin:20px 0 0 23px; display:block; height:190px; background:url(chan_bg.gif) no-repeat}
.xiazai_zuotu { float:left; width:160px; height:140px; background:url(chan_tu.gif) no-repeat; margin:20px 0 0 20px; padding:10px 0 0 170px;}
.xiazai_zuotu h1 { font-size:16px;}
.xiazai_mianfei { margin-top:8px;}
.anzuo { float:left; width:245px; height:120px; margin:20px 0 0 114px;}
.xiazai_wen {float:left; width:757px; margin:20px 0 0 23px; display:block; height:auto; font-size:14px;}
.jietu {background:url(xiazai_jietu.gif) no-repeat; width:690px; height:270px; padding:30px;}

.news_neirong { float:left; width:750px; margin:20px 0 0 23px;}
.news_neirong li { float:left; height:90px; width:750px; border-bottom:1px #ddd solid; margin:10px 0;}
.news_h1 {font-size:14px; margin-bottom:10px; color:#444}
.news_neirong p { text-indent:0px;}
.news_time {color:#aaa; margin-left:20px;}
.news_neirong a { color:#888}

.news_neirong_re{float:left; width:960px; margin:20px 0 0 23px; font-size:14px; line-height:30px}
.news_neirong_re h1 { font-size:25px; margin-bottom:20px;}
.news_neirong_re p {text-indent:2em;}

.fanye { float:left; margin:20px 0 20px 23px; width:100%;}
ul.nylist{ display:block; float:left; overflow:hidden;}
ul.nylistcen{ float:none; margin:0 auto 5px;display:block; width:280px;}
ul.nylist li a.first,ul.nylist li a.last{ width:30px;}
ul.nylist li a{width:30px; display:block; height:30px; text-align:center; line-height:30px;background:#fff; border:1px solid #e2e2e2;color:#808080;}
ul.nylist li a:hover{background:#d0d0da;border:#bbb 1px solid}
ul.nylist li a.selBg{background:#48965c;border:#48965c 1px solid; color:#FFF}
ul.nylist li.first{margin:0}
ul.nylist li.dian{ border:none; background:none}
ul.nylist li{ float:left;margin-left:5px; height:32px;}

#scrollBtn{ width:48px; position:fixed; right:25px; bottom:50px;}
#scrollBtn a{ display:block; width:48px; height:54px; background:url(back_top.gif) no-repeat; text-indent:-9999px; overflow:hidden; white-space:nowrap; margin-bottom:1px;}
#scrollBtn #upBtn{ background-position:-48px 0; display:none;}
#scrollBtn a:hover#upBtn{ background-position:0 0;}
#scrollBtn #tengai{ background-position:-48px -48px;}
#scrollBtn a:hover#tengai{ background-position:0 -48px;}

.us_tit_law { background:url(law.gif) no-repeat 15px 20px; height:90px;}
.article p{color:#777777; text-indent:2em; line-height:24px; padding-bottom:20px;}
.article .indent_0{text-indent:0; padding-bottom:0;}